Ramy Youssef Full Overview and Wiki
Early Life and Rise to Fame
Born to Egyptian immigrants in Queens, New York, Ramy Youssef‘s journey is a tale of cultural intersections.
Growing up in a Muslim household in Rutherford, New Jersey, Youssef’s early life was a blend of traditional Egyptian values and the quintessential American dream.
His foray into the entertainment world began at Rutherford High School, where his talent first shone. Despite enrolling in Rutgers University for political science and economics, Youssef’s passion for acting led him to leave academia and pursue his dreams.
Breakthrough and Acclaim
Youssef’s acting debut in See Dad Run on Nick at Nite was just the start. His true breakout came with the Hulu original series Ramy, where he not only starred but also served as a writer and director.
This series, a blend of comedy and drama, delves into the life of a millennial Muslim living in America, a narrative that earned him critical acclaim, including a Golden Globe Award and a Peabody Award.
Stand-up Comedy and HBO Special
Apart from Ramy, Youssef’s versatility shines through his various roles, including his appearance in Mr. Robot and his HBO stand-up special Feelings. His work extends beyond acting, evident in his co-creation of the Netflix series Mo.
Youssef’s talent has been recognized with multiple nominations, including the Primetime Emmy Awards, further solidifying his status in the industry.

FAQs about Ramy Youssef
Who is Ramy Youssef?
He is an American actor, comedian, writer, and director known for creating and starring in the Hulu series Ramy, which explores the life of a first-generation American Muslim. He was born on March 26, 1991, in Queens, New York .
What are some of Youssef’s notable works?
Besides Ramy, Youssef has appeared in Mr. Robot, See Dad Run, and voiced characters in animated films like Wish. He’s also known for his HBO comedy specials, Feelings and More Feelings.
Has Ramy Youssef won any awards?
Yes, Youssef has won a Golden Globe for Best Actor in a Television Series Musical or Comedy for Ramy and received various nominations, including Emmy, Peabody, and Screen Actors Guild Awards.

What are his thoughts on directing?
Youssef has expressed excitement about directing, particularly episodes of The Bear, and enjoys exploring different emotional states and ensemble dynamics through his storytelling.
Has Ramy Youssef been involved in charity work?
Yes, he held a fundraising show for Palestine in December 2023, with proceeds going to Gaza. The event attracted attention and was attended by celebrities like Taylor Swift and Selena Gomez.
